Looks amazing. But it's still going to aimed at the young american audience with very little true rallying and a ton of trucks, buggies and other pointless dirt track racing discipines, I assume!

While improved water and dust effects will shift a few more copies, the backwards step from the old games moving towards simulation to the near arcade style of the last was incredibly disappointing, as a previously committed long-term fan. Still, it doesn't stop the presenter from giving us the usual line that accompanies the release of every racing game; "improved handling". I don't understand why any developer bothers saying this any more... arcade racers sell well. If racing game sales are anything to go by, everyone wants and loves arcade, lightweight racing games. I assume there's only about a handful of us out there who actually want racing to emulate real life. This probably explains why online racing in the orignal Dirt completely ditched custom car setups. Surely it's only a matter of time before all the actual rallying is dropped in this series.
